Riverview Hospital

Wisconsin Rapids, Wisconsin

Founded in 1912 by concerned community leaders, Riverview Hospital remains an independent, community-owned and operated healthcare provider under the direction of the Riverview Hospital Association. Licensed for 99 beds, Riverview Hospital currently has a capacity of 79 beds for inpatient care and provides a wide range of outpatient services. Some of these services include cardiopulmonary rehabilitation, a diabetes and nutrition center, imaging services, surgery and outpatient procedures and a sleep lab.

Riverview Hospital Association primarily serves the 50,000 people who live in South Wood County, including the cities of Wisconsin Rapids and Nekoosa, villages of Port Edwards, Biron, Rudolph and Vesper, the towns of Grand Rapids and Saratoga, and various perimeter townships. Riverview also serves the adjacent Lakes recreational area in the far northern Adams County town of Rome, which includes the communities of Lake Arrowhead, Lake Sherwood and Lake Camelot.

Infinity HealthCare has provided Emergency Medicine staffing and management services since 2009. With an annual patient census of 28,000, this Level III Trauma Center and Fast Track is staffed with residency trained, board certified Emergency Medicine physicians and physician extenders.
